Buffett follows the Benjamin Graham school of worth investing, which looks for securities whose rates are unjustifiably low based on their intrinsic worth.

Some of the elements Buffett thinks about are business performance, company financial obligation, and revenue margins. Other considerations for worth investors like Buffett include whether business are public, how reliant they are on commodities, and how cheap they are. Warren Buffett was born in Omaha in 1930. He developed an interest in the business world and investing at an early age including in the stock market. warren buffett quotes restraint.

Buffett later on went to the Columbia Organization School where he earned his academic degree in economics. Buffett started his profession as an investment sales representative in the early 1950s but formed Buffett Associates in 1956. Less than ten years later, in 1965, he was in control of Berkshire Hathaway. In June 2006, Buffett revealed his plans to contribute his whole fortune to charity.

Value investors try to find securities with prices that are unjustifiably low based on their intrinsic worth - warren buffett quotes restraint. There isn't a widely accepted way to determine intrinsic worth, but it's frequently approximated by analyzing a business's basics. Like deal hunters, the worth investor look for stocks thought to be undervalued by the market, or stocks that are valuable however not recognized by the majority of other purchasers.

Numerous value investors do not support the efficient market hypothesis (EMH). This theory recommends that stocks always trade at their fair value, which makes it harder for investors to either buy stocks that are underestimated or offer them at inflated prices. They do trust that the marketplace will eventually start to prefer those quality stocks that were, for a time, undervalued.

Buffett, nevertheless, isn't worried about the supply and demand complexities of the stock exchange. In reality, he's not actually interested in the activities of the stock exchange at all. This is the ramification in his well-known paraphrase of a Benjamin Graham quote: "In the brief run, the market is a voting device however in the long run it is a weighing machine." He takes a look at each business as an entire, so he chooses stocks exclusively based on their general capacity as a business.

When Buffett purchases a company, he isn't worried with whether the market will ultimately recognize its worth. He is worried about how well that company can generate income as a business. Warren Buffett finds low-cost value by asking himself some concerns when he evaluates the relationship between a stock's level of quality and its price.

Sometimes return on equity (ROE) is referred to as investor's return on investment. It reveals the rate at which shareholders earn income on their shares. Buffett constantly takes a look at ROE to see whether a company has actually regularly performed well compared to other business in the same market. ROE is calculated as follows: ROE = Earnings Shareholder's Equity Taking a look at the ROE in just the in 2015 isn't enough.

The debt-to-equity ratio (D/E) is another essential particular Buffett considers thoroughly. Buffett chooses to see a little amount of financial obligation so that profits development is being produced from investors' equity rather than borrowed cash. The D/E ratio is computed as follows: Debt-to-Equity Ratio = Overall Liabilities Shareholders' Equity This ratio shows the percentage of equity and debt the company uses to fund its properties, and the higher the ratio, the more debtrather than equityis financing the business.

For a more rigid test, financiers in some cases use only long-lasting debt instead of overall liabilities in the computation above. A business's success depends not just on having an excellent revenue margin, but likewise on consistently increasing it. This margin is determined by dividing earnings by net sales (warren buffett quotes restraint). For a great indication of historical profit margins, investors should recall at least 5 years.

Buffett generally considers only business that have been around for at least 10 years. As a result, many of the innovation business that have actually had their initial public offering (IPOs) in the previous years wouldn't get on Buffett's radar. He's stated he doesn't understand the mechanics behind a number of today's innovation companies, and only invests in a business that he completely comprehends.
